I am very interested in the documentation as I need a lot of help moving...forward. So, I would like to start with my finds where I have difficulties; not that there are problems, but I have concerns. Starting from the wiki you pointed to:

1) The first step is: Non-Eclipse System Requirements
a) 'Supported Databases' takes us to the Postgresql pages where the first opportunity to down load is the 'one click installer' for version 8.4.4. Is this the necessary version?
b) 'Install Eclipse' takes us to the page where we can download version 3.6.0. But in the same section of the wiki, 'Eclipse Dependencies' it says to use version 3.5.
c) 'Notes' goes into coordination of 3.5.0 and 3.5.1 and OSEE 0.8.3.
From the above, I can tell if these are just alternative opportunities or specific requirements to the latest OSEE.

2) The next step is: Launch Application Server
a) The first line says to see the 'User's Guide' for more information. But we are already in the User Guide.
b) The 'Instructions' sections points to the 'microdoc' site. This site seems to address 'OSEE Application Server 0.8.3. I do not know if these instruction are still valid or if the download link is the correct version since it states 0.8.3. And also points to a 0.7.0 version. The page continues with the OSEE Client 0.7.0.
c) At the bottom of the 'microdoc' site, it addresses an add-on package labeled 0.7. Is this package something that should be used with the latest version?

3) The next section addresses 'Application Server Launch Instructions'.
a) There are no instructions for ' <ConnectionId>
b) There are no instructions for '<VersionForYourEclipse>'.
The page says to see the User Guide, but this is the guide.

I really appreciate everyone's efforts. I hope that I have contributed some value to helping people learn about OSEE. I know I can really use some help.

Dear Ray,

Sorry for the late reply - things are very busy for me at the moment.

1)
a) I have not verified that Postgres 8.4.4 works with OSEE but it is very unlikely that it won't - I have three different Postgres versions running with my various Linux and Windows OSEE installs and they all behave the same. Hence, linking to the latest version of Postgres from the instructions makes sense to me.

b) I have added a link to the last version of 3.5

c) Note has been clarified

2)
a) Line removed
b) No it doesn't. It says to go to that site if you are using microdoc. However, there is no explanation of what microdoc is earlier in the text, which is more than a little confusing. I will attempt to address this better when time permits
c) Microdoc does not contain the latest OSEE - this is available from the Download link.

3) Please see the example - this should allow you to work out what you need for your specific set-up
